(by Shirley McNevich)
2lb. ground chuck
1 onion (chopped)
1 tsp. salt
1/2 tsp. pepper
1 large jar of your favorite spaghetti sauce
1 - 8oz. bag medium wide egg noodles
1 - 8oz. bag shredded mozzarella cheese
1/2 cup chopped green peppers
1/2 cup chopped pepperoni
1 tsp. oregano
In a skillet add ground chuck, chopped onions, chopped green
peppers, chopped pepperoni, oregano, salt and pepper--stir and cook
over medium heat until beef is browned. Add the spaghetti sauce--stir.
Cook noodles separately according to bag directions--drain. Add
drained noodles to the meat sauce--stir. Pour everything into a large
greased casserole dish. Bake at 350 degrees for 15-20 minutes;
remove from oven and sprinkle shredded mozzarella cheese over the
top. Return to oven and bake until cheese is melted.
